Here's everything you need for these decadent chocolate chip cookie cheesecake bars. These bars are easy to make, and can be turned into a gluten-free version.

Ingredients to Gather

Cookie Dough Portion:
1 cup butter , softened
1 1/2 cups light brown sugar
2 tsp vanilla extract
1 egg
2 cups all purpose flour
1 tsp baking soda
1 tsp salt
1 cup chocolate chips or chunks
Cheesecake Portion:
8 oz cream cheese , softened
1/2 cup sugar
1 egg
1 tsp vanilla extract

Directions to Follow

Preheat oven to 350 degrees F.
Line a 13×9 baking pan with foil or parchment paper.
Using an electric mixer, beat together the butter and brown sugar until light and creamy. Add vanilla and egg and beat until well incorporated.
Mix in the flour, baking soda and salt until just combined. Mix in the chocolate chips.
Press half of the cookie dough mixture into the bottom of your prepared pan.
In a separate bowl, beat together the cream cheese and sugar until smooth. Add in the egg and vanilla and beat until well combined.
Pour the cheesecake layer over the cookie layer in your pan. Using a spatula if needed, spread to cover your cookie dough.

Now, take small handfuls of the remaining dough and use your hands to flatten them. Take the flattened dough balls and place them on top of the cheesecake mixture, and then bake until the bars are starting to get lightly brown and the center of the bars is set, usually between 28 and 33 minutes. When they're done, remove them from the oven and let them cool on a wire rack and then keep them in the refrigerator.
